ALTER CONVERSION
Name
ALTER CONVERSION -- 修改一个编码转换的定义
Synopsis
ALTER CONVERSION name RENAME TO newname
ALTER CONVERSION name OWNER TO newowner
描述
ALTER CONVERSION 修改一个编码转换的定义。
要使用 ALTER CONVERSION,你必须拥有该编码转换。
要修改其所有者,你必须是新的所有角色的直接或者间接成员,并且该角色还必须在该编码转换的模式上有
CREATE 权限。(这些限制就保证了修改所有者和删除、重建编码转换没有太多不同。
不过,超级用户可以以任何方式修改任意编码转换的所有权。)
参数
- name
一个现有的编码转换的名字(可以有模式修饰)。
- newname
转换的新名字。
- newowner
编码转换的新所有者。
例子
把编码转换 iso_8859_1_to_utf8 重新命名为 latin1_to_unicode:
ALTER CONVERSION iso_8859_1_to_utf8 RENAME TO latin1_to_unicode;
把编码转换 iso_8859_1_to_utf8 的所有者改变为 joe:
ALTER CONVERSION iso_8859_1_to_utf8 OWNER TO joe;
兼容性
SQL 标准里没有 ALTER CONVERSION 语句。